    17, GREEN LANE, WALLASEY, CH45 8JJ

    This terraced freehold property on Green Lane last sold in May 2015 for £141,500. Based on price growth in the CH45 district since then, its estimated current value is £221,698 — placing it in the 30th percentile nationally and the 50th percentile within CH45. The property covers 119 m² (1,281 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,863 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.
